What You Need to Know About the Two New National Parks Rwanda May Gain in the Coming Years

Rwanda is studying plans to establish two new national parks: the Lake Kivu Islands National Park and the Rugezi, Burera and Ruhondo National Park, which could bring the country’s total number of national parks to six by 2028.

More Than 30 Experts Study the Proposed Parks

The Rwanda Development Board (RDB) has announced that more than 30 experts from different countries have begun studying how the two proposed national parks could be established.

The announcement comes more than a year after RDB Deputy Chief Executive Officer Juliana Kangeli Muganza told senators that Rwanda was planning to establish an Islands National Park by 2028.

Dr. Deo Ruhagaze, Deputy Director of the Rwanda Wildlife Conservation Association (RWCA), said the organisation welcomed the government’s plan and committed to supporting the feasibility study. “These will be two separate parks: the Rugezi Wetland and the islands of Lakes Burera and Ruhondo National Park, and the Lake Kivu Islands National Park. Today, we have a team of more than 30 experts studying how this project can be implemented.”

The team includes experts in business, biodiversity, community livelihoods and economics. It is also working with representatives from REMA, RFA, WASAC, RDB and the Rwanda Water Resources Board.

Lake Kivu Islands Could Become a National Park

Lake Kivu has 113 islands, including 42 in Rutsiro District. Some of the islands are inhabited, while others are used for activities such as agriculture.

Lake Kivu has 113 islands.

The islands also contain historical and natural attractions that could become important tourism resources if they are properly managed and protected. Dr. Ange Imanishimwe, founder of BIOCOOR, said the islands have experienced human activities for many years because they lack a stable management system. “If a park bringing together the islands of Lake Kivu is established, those islands will be protected because clear laws and guidelines for their sustainable use will be put in place.”

He said establishing the park would also help protect vegetation and biodiversity while contributing to Rwanda’s tourism and foreign exchange earnings. Prof. Elias Bizuru, a biodiversity expert and lecturer at the University of Rwanda, said research had identified unique species on the islands. “Lake Kivu has 28 species of fish and is also home to otters. Turning it into a park would bring benefits for tourism, biodiversity conservation, local communities and the country.”

Tourism Could Benefit Local Communities

Niyomugabo Moise, who leads a 40-member cooperative that takes tourists around Lake Kivu, said the area already attracts many visitors.

According to him, the cooperative can guide about 1,000 tourists per month during busy periods, with around 70% coming from outside Africa. During the low season, the number falls to about 300 tourists. “They are curious to travel around Lake Kivu, see its biodiversity and visit the islands. Turning the Lake Kivu islands into a national park would help us develop further because, as we have seen elsewhere, national parks work with local communities.”

He believes the creation of a national park could increase the number of visitors by making the islands better known.

Rugezi, Burera and Ruhondo Have Unique Biodiversity

The second proposed park would bring together the Rugezi Wetland and the islands of Lakes Burera and Ruhondo. Rugezi Wetland covers about 6,735 hectares and is located in Burera and Gicumbi districts in northern Rwanda. Situated at about 2,100 metres above sea level, it is an important source of water flowing into the Nile River.

The wetland also supplies water used by the Ntaruka hydropower plant. Dr. Deo Ruhagaze said the proposed park would have particular importance because Rugezi is home to about half of Rwanda’s grey crowned cranes.

The number of grey crowned cranes in the wetland has increased from 71 in 2015 to 378 over the past 10 years. “If Rugezi, Burera and Ruhondo become a national park, they will contribute to protecting the biodiversity found in this wetland and on the islands of Lakes Burera and Ruhondo, particularly the grey crowned cranes and the many reptiles found there.”

How Rwanda Establishes a National Park

Establishing a national park in Rwanda involves several stages. First, an area with potential for national park status is identified and landowners are informed about the proposal. Environmental and social impact assessments are then conducted, followed by consideration of any concerns or objections. The boundaries of the proposed park are subsequently established before the park is officially approved and created in accordance with Article 10 of Law No. 14/2023 governing national parks and protected areas.

Frank Dushimimana, an RDB official responsible for wildlife conservation and protected areas, said the study of the Lake Kivu islands began four months ago. “The study has already begun, and in the coming days the team will also reach out to local residents so that the study is guided by what is beneficial to the community.”

Rwanda Could Have Six National Parks

Rwanda currently has three national parks: Volcanoes National Park, Akagera National Park and Nyungwe National Park.

If the two proposed parks are established, the country would have six national parks.

The expansion would also support the government’s target of increasing tourism revenue from $645 million in 2024 to $1.1 billion by 2029.

Proposed Parks Could Be Established by 2028

The team conducting the feasibility study expects to complete its work by 2027. If the necessary studies, consultations and approval processes are successfully completed, the Lake Kivu Islands National Park and the Rugezi, Burera and Ruhondo National Park could be established by 2028.

The twin lakes of Burera and Ruhondo are already among Rwanda’s major natural attractions, with Lake Burera alone having nine islands.

Rugezi Marsh is located between Burera and Gicumbi.
